Switch convenient for rapid installation
By incorporating wire mounting holes, copper busbar slots, and PCB slots into the electrical switch, and utilizing an operating mechanism and snap-fit structure, the problems of cumbersome installation and high maintenance costs of existing electrical switches are solved, enabling rapid installation and disassembly, and improving work efficiency and safety.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of electrical switch technology, and in particular to a switch that is easy to install quickly. Background Technology
[0002] A switch is a commonly used power distribution product for controlling the on / off state of electrical circuits, widely used in power, railway, communications, construction, agriculture, and industry. Currently, commonly used switches have wire mounting holes at both ends, secured with screws, and are internally electrically connected. The circuit is controlled by a front-end operating mechanism, and the most common configuration is top-in, bottom-out. When multiple switches are used in parallel, a busbar needs to be installed on one side of the switch to supply power to multiple terminals simultaneously. Each switch's mounting screws must be tightened, resulting in low installation efficiency. If a switch malfunctions and needs replacement, the entire busbar must be removed, and the busbar reinstalled after replacing the switch. This process is prone to errors, such as forgetting to tighten certain switch mounting screws, and the disassembly and reassembly of the busbar is time-consuming and labor-intensive, increasing maintenance time and labor costs.
[0003] Therefore, it is necessary to design a switch that can be quickly installed and replaced and is easy to operate.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this utility model is to provide a switch that is easy to install quickly and is simple to operate, which can solve the problems of cumbersome operation and low installation efficiency of electrical switch replacement in the prior art.
[0005] This utility model provides a switch that is easy to install quickly, including a housing, on which an operating mechanism is provided; the housing has a positive wire mounting hole and a negative wire mounting hole, and a first conductive element and a second conductive element are respectively provided at the bottom of the positive wire mounting hole and the negative wire mounting hole; a positive copper busbar slot and a negative copper busbar slot are provided on the side wall of the housing away from the operating mechanism, and a third conductive element and a fourth conductive element are respectively provided on one side of the positive copper busbar slot and the negative copper busbar slot; the connection and disconnection of the first conductive element and the third conductive element, and the second conductive element and the fourth conductive element are controlled by the operating mechanism.
[0006] Furthermore, a PCB slot is provided between the positive copper busbar slot and the negative copper busbar slot; a fifth conductive element is provided inside the housing on one side of the PCB slot.
[0007] Furthermore, spring contacts are provided on the two opposite sidewalls of the positive copper busbar slot, the negative copper busbar slot, and the PCB slot.
[0008] Furthermore, both ends of the positive copper busbar slot, the negative copper busbar slot, and the PCB slot are open ends.
[0009] Furthermore, the positive copper busbar slot, the negative copper busbar slot, and the PCB slot are all U-shaped.
[0010] Furthermore, the positive electrode mounting hole and the negative electrode mounting hole are arranged adjacent to each other along the width direction of the housing, and the positions of the positive electrode mounting hole and the negative electrode mounting hole are at different heights.
[0011] Furthermore, the axes of both the positive electrode mounting hole and the negative electrode mounting hole are perpendicular to the horizontal plane, and the planes where their openings are located are parallel to the horizontal plane.
[0012] Furthermore, fastening screws are provided on the sidewalls of both the positive electrode mounting hole and the negative electrode mounting hole.
[0013] Furthermore, a buckle is provided on the upper part of the side wall of the housing away from the operating mechanism, and the buckle engages with the switch rail inside the electrical control box.
[0014] In summary, this utility model has the following advantages:
[0015] The technical solution of this utility model controls the connection and disconnection of the first and third conductive components, and the second and fourth conductive components through an operating mechanism, thereby realizing the connection and disconnection of the circuit. When the switch is installed in an electrical control box, the positive and negative copper busbars are directly inserted into the positive and negative copper busbar slots respectively, the housing is snapped onto the guide rail, and finally the wires are installed in the positive and negative wire mounting holes respectively. The operation is simple and convenient. When the switch needs to be replaced, the wires are removed, the housing is separated from the guide rail, and the switch can be pulled out directly. The switch provided by this utility model is simple and convenient to install and disassemble, and when multiple sets of switches are used, replacing any set will not affect each other, greatly saving the time and labor costs of installation and maintenance. [0028] Example
[0029] A switch that is easy to install quickly, such as Figure 1 and Figure 2 As shown, the device includes a housing 1, an operating mechanism 2, a positive electrode wire mounting hole 7, and a negative electrode wire mounting hole 8. A first conductive element 9 and a second conductive element 10 are respectively located at the bottom of the positive electrode wire m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ode wire mounting hole 8. A positive electrode copper busbar slot 3 and a negative electrode copper busbar slot 4 are located on the side wall of the housing 1 away from the operating mechanism 2. A third conductive element 12 and a fourth conductive element 13 located inside the housing 1 are respectively located on one side of the positive electrode copper busbar slot 3 and the negative electrode copper busbar slot 4. The connection and disconnection of the first conductive element 9 and the third conductive element 12, and the second conductive element 10 and the fourth conductive element 13 are controlled by the operating mechanism 2. The operating mechanism 2 adopts a conventional operating mechanism in the prior art. Figure 2 and Figure 4 The specific structure of the operating mechanism 2 is omitted.
[0030] Both the positive electrode m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ode mounting hole 8 are located on the top of the housing 1 and are adjacent to each other along the width direction of the housing 1. The positive electrode mounting hole 7 is positioned higher than the negative electrode mounting hole 8. The axes of both the positive electrode m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ode mounting hole 8 are perpendicular to the horizontal plane, and the planes of their openings are parallel to the horizontal plane. A first conductive element 9 and a second conductive element 10 are respectively provided at the bottom of the positive electrode m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ode mounting hole 8. Fastening screws 11 are provided on the side walls of both the positive electrode m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ode mounting hole 8. During installation, the positive electrode output wire and the negative electrode output wire are inserted into the positive electrode mounting hole 7 and the negative electrode mounting hole 8 respectively, ensuring full contact and connection between the positive electrode output wire and the first conductive element 9 and the second conductive element 10, and then the fastening screws 11 are tightened for fixation.
[0031] A PCB slot 5 is also provided between the positive copper busbar slot 3 and the negative copper busbar slot 4; a fifth conductive element 14 is provided inside the housing 1 on one side of the PCB slot 5.
[0032] like Figure 3 As shown, the positive copper busbar slot 3, the negative copper busbar slot 4, and the PCB slot 5 are each provided with a spring clip 6 on their two opposite side walls. In use, the positive copper busbar, negative copper busbar, and PCB are inserted into the positive copper busbar slot 3, negative copper busbar slot 4, and PCB slot 5, respectively. The spring clips 6 connect the positive and negative copper busbars to the third conductive element 12 and the fourth conductive element 13, respectively, and the PCB to the fifth conductive element 14. The spring clips 6 also clamp and secure the positive copper busbar, negative copper busbar, and PCB.
[0033] By manipulating the operating mechanism 2, the first conductive element 9 is connected to the third conductive element 12, and the second conductive element 10 is connected to the fourth conductive element 13, forming a circuit with the positive output wire, the negative output wire, the positive copper busbar, and the negative copper busbar. When the fifth conductive element 14 is connected to the PCB via the spring contact 6, the address bit of this switch is selected by the PCB.
[0034] The positive copper busbar slot 3, the negative copper busbar slot 4, and the PCB slot 5 all have open ends, and all three are U-shaped and parallel to each other. In use, the positive copper busbar, negative copper busbar, and PCB are simply inserted into their respective slots, making operation simple and convenient.
[0035] A latch 15 is provided on the upper part of the rear side wall of housing 1 (i.e., the side wall away from operating mechanism 2), and the latch 15 engages with the switch rail inside the electrical control box. The latch 15 adopts a conventional latch structure in the prior art, therefore...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 4 The specific structure of buckle 15 is omitted.
[0036] The housing 1 can be made of plastic material commonly used for switches in this field.
[0037] The method of using the switch provided in this embodiment is as follows: When the switch is connected, such as Figure 4As shown, the positive copper busbar slot 3, negative copper busbar slot 4, and PCB slot 5 on the rear side of the housing 1 are directly snapped onto the positive copper busbar 16, negative copper busbar 17, and PCB 18 inside the electrical control box. The input wire only needs to be connected to one end of the copper busbar. The switch is fixed to the guide rail 19 inside the electrical control box by the clip 15. After snapping, the positive copper busbar 16 and negative copper busbar 17 are connected to the third conductive element 12 and the fourth conductive element 13 respectively via the spring contact 6. The PCB 18 is connected to the fifth conductive element 14 via the spring contact 6. The positive and negative output wires are installed in the positive wire mounting hole 7 and the negative wire mounting hole 8 respectively using fastening screws 11. The operating mechanism 2 connects the first conductive element 9 to the third conductive element 12 and the second conductive element 10 to the fourth conductive element 13. If multiple sets of output wires are required, multiple switches can be snapped onto the same copper busbar sequentially. Figure 5 As shown.
[0038] When the switch needs to be replaced, turn the fastening screw 11 to remove the positive output wire and the negative output wire, pry up the clip 15, and pull the switch out directly. Replacing any one of the multiple sets of switches will not affect each other.
[0039] Switches commonly used in the prior art, such as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, its two wire mounting holes are located at the top and bottom of the housing, respectively. During electrical installation, wires need to be installed from the top and bottom of the switch, respectively. In the limited space of the distribution box or electrical cabinet, the routing and arrangement of wires are restricted, increasing the difficulty and workload of wiring, and also making it inconvenient for later inspection and maintenance. This invention, however, places the two wire mounting holes at the top of the switch, allowing all wires to be connected from the top of the switch. This makes the wiring more centralized and orderly, making it easier to plan the routing of wires in the distribution box or electrical cabinet, facilitating organization and bundling, and making the entire wiring system neater and more aesthetically pleasing. It also facilitates later inspection and maintenance, and better utilizes the space below the switch, making the layout of electrical equipment or the installation environment more compact and reasonable.
[0040] Traditional switches are often connected to copper busbars using bolts, which is cumbersome and requires tools. This invention, however, uses a switch with corresponding slots and springs, allowing for tool-free connection to the copper busbar and PCB; simply insert the switch. This simplified operation solution is straightforward.
[0041] The switch provided by this utility model is easy to assemble and disassemble quickly, has strong versatility, and is simple to operate. It can improve work efficiency, avoid live work, and improve personal safety.
